Chalti Ka Naam Zindagi (1982) is a 156-minute Hindi film directed by Kishore Kumar. Starring Ashok Kumar and Anoop Kumar. With an audience rating of 7.2/10, Chalti Ka Naam Zindagi stands as one of the notable Hindi releases of 1982.
